While there is no ticket office at Brunstane, passengers can conveniently purchase and collect tickets using the available ticket machines. Those who prefer to buy tickets online can easily collect them from these machines, which are designed to be accessible, including for those using mobility aids, ensuring a smooth experience for everyone.
Brunstane station is equipped with departure screens and loudspeaker announcements to keep travelers informed about train schedules. Although no dedicated staff is on-site to offer assistance, help points are strategically placed for immediate support. Furthermore, passengers with hearing aids will find induction loops available at the station.
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access available to a single platform, making travel easier for anyone with mobility impairments. However, you might want to plan ahead if requiring facilities like ramps or accessible toilets, which are not available at Brunstane. Customer service support can be reached via email, and lost property inquiries can be handled through ScotRail’s resources.
Traveling to and from Brunstane continues to be easy and efficient. If rail services are replaced by buses, these can be caught at the nearby Milton Road East bus stop, as detailed on What3Words. For those looking to explore more of Edinburgh through public transport, Traveline Scotland offers comprehensive details on local bus services. Taxi options are also available, and further details can be found on TrainTaxi’s website.

Lea Green train station is equipped to make your travel experience as smooth as possible. With a ticket office open from dawn until midnight on weekdays and extended hours on weekends, purchasing or collecting your tickets is hassle-free. The station boasts accessible ticket machines and induction loops for the hearing impaired. If you're using a smartcard for your journey, rest assured that both issuance and validation can be handled at the station.
Despite the lack of refreshment facilities or waiting rooms, the station does offer seating areas for a comfortable wait. It is important to note the absence of toilets and baby changing facilities. Additionally, steps provide access to the platforms, though lengthy ramps are available for those in need of step-free pathways. However, there are no accessible taxis available, so make sure to plan ahead if additional transport assistance is needed.
Lea Green station offers numerous transport options for your onward journey. Buses are conveniently accessible right outside the station, with a bus interchange linking passengers to various local routes. For those requiring taxis, you can find more information and make bookings through services like Cab4You. If you’re in need of a bike rental, however, it's worth mentioning that this service isn't available on-site.
